In Los Angeles, five unauthorized immigrants were arrested for fraudulently using counterfeit electronic benefit transfer (EBT) cards to withdraw funds meant for low-income families. They possessed over 160 counterfeit cards and allegedly stole about $25,480 from multiple benefit programs. The U.S. Department of Justice highlighted the significant impact of their actions on vulnerable communities. EBT fraud remains a significant issue in California, with over $126 million reported stolen in 2024 alone.
These defendants who are illegally in the United States targeted and stole from some of the poorest members of our community, contributing to significant financial losses.
The amount the men are accused of stealing is just a drop in the bucket of the total that goes missing every year, highlighting the rampant problem of EBT fraud.
